South Africa's Social Relief of Distress (SRD) Grant, typically referred to as the R350 grant resulting from its month to month payout, is a lifeline for many vulnerable folks while in the country.

The South African Social Security Agency (SASSA) is chargeable for this initiative, geared toward delivering momentary financial support to those in serious financial need.

1. Exactly what is the SRD Grant?

The SRD Grant, managed by SASSA, is a temporary provision of aid intended for people in these types of dire material need that they are not able to meet up with their or their family members' most simple desires. This grant was significantly highlighted in the COVID-19 pandemic as a method that will help those going through intense economic hardship.

2. That's Qualified?

To qualify for that SRD grant:

You should be considered a South African citizen, copyright, or refugee registered on the Home Affairs database.
You have to be currently residing in the borders of South Africa.
You have to be higher than the age of eighteen.
You have to be unemployed.
You will need to not be receiving any kind of cash flow.
You need to not be getting any social grant.
You will need to not be acquiring any unemployment insurance benefit and would not qualify to acquire unemployment insurance policy Positive aspects.

You will need to not be obtaining a stipend within the National Student Financial Aid Scheme NSFAS or other financial aid.
You must not sassa appeal be residing within a government-funded or subsidized institution.

3. How to Apply?

Applications with the SRD grant can be carried out by means of a variety of methods:

Online Platform: SASSA incorporates a dedicated on the net platform where applications is usually submitted. Make sure you have all required documents ready for upload.

WhatsApp: There is a committed SASSA WhatsApp quantity for SRD grant applications. Stick to the prompts as you initiate a chat.

SMS/ USSD: You may use a particular code provided by SASSA to use by way of SMS or USSD. This process may contain costs related to your community service provider.

Email: There's also an option to email your application. Guarantee all necessary documentation is connected.

Bear in mind, it's essential to supply precise and finish information when making use of. Misrepresentation may perhaps lead to disqualification or authorized steps.
